UK Citizenship for child

Post by skyblue99 » Mon Feb 06, 2023 11:12 pm

Hello, I live in Canada with my wife and daughter. I’m a Canadian citizen. My wife is a British and a Canadian Citizen. She became a British citizen in 2014 through 10 years route. My daughter was born in September last year in Canada. My question is, is my daughter eligible to apply for British citizenship/passport through her mom from Canada? If yes please let me know how. Re: UK Citizenship for child

Post by meself2 » Mon Feb 06, 2023 11:18 pm

She is British by descent.
https://www.gov.uk/apply-citizenship-br ... -july-2006
You’re automatically a British citizen if you were born outside the UK and all of the following apply:

you were born on or after 1 July 2006
your mother or father was a British citizen when you were born
your British parent could pass on their citizenship to you
Apply for a passport for her. You can start with this link: https://www.gov.uk/overseas-passports

Note she won't be able to pass citizenship to her children.
